What the multiple means
Operating leverage is contribution over profit. A DOL of 5 means every point of revenue growth is five points of profit growth, and every point of revenue lost is five points of profit gone.
High leverage is wonderful on the way up and brutal on the way down, which is why the growth plan and the downside plan are the same spreadsheet with the sign flipped.
This is also why customer concentration hurts: the profit a leaving customer takes is exactly their revenue share times this multiple.
